    Dr. Patrik Frei is founder and CEO of Venture Valuation AG, Switzerland. Patrik graduated from the Business University of St. Gallen and completed his Ph.D thesis (”Assessment and valuation of high growth companies”) at the Swiss Federal Institute of Technology, EPFL Lausanne. Prior to forming Venture Valuation, Patrik was CFO of a logistic company and  worked for several international corporations: LeCroy (Geneva, New York), Hans Merensky Holding (South Africa) and Swatch Group - EM Microelectronic (Marin). Patrik is a board member and one of the original founders of ineo, a holding company of the Swiss dental implant VC-backed firm Thommen Medical and a board member of Ophthalmopharma, a Swiss based biotech ophthalmology company.  Patrik’s articles have been published in a number of scientific journals including “Nature Biotechnology”, “Chimia” and other business publications (“Starting a Business in the Life Sciences: From Idea to Market” and “Building Biotechnology: Starting, Managing, and Understanding Biotechnology Companies”).   He has also lectured at Seoul National University, South Korea and Danube University Krems, Austria and presented at numerous Valuation workshops around the world.  More recently, Patrik was named as one of the 20 most influential people in the Swiss Life Sciences Industry by Bilan, a Swiss Business Journal along with other noteworthy individuals such as Ernesto Bertarelli, Daniel Vasella and Henry B. Meier.
